Histogram i R-språk
Ett histogram innehåller ett rektangulärt område för att visa den statistiska informationen som är proportionell mot frekvensen av en variabel och dess bredd i successiva numeriska intervall. En grafisk representation som hanterar en grupp av datapunkter i olika specificerade intervall. Den har en speciell funktion som inte visar några luckor mellan staplarna och liknar ett vertikalt stapeldiagram.
R – Histogram
Vi kan skapa histogram i programmeringsspråket R med hjälp av funktionen hist().
Syntax: hist(v, main, xlab, xlim, ylim, breaks, col, border)
Parametrar:
v: Den här parametern innehåller numeriska värden som används i histogram. main: Denna parameter main är titeln på diagrammet. col: Denna parameter används för att ställa in färgen på staplarna. xlab: Denna parameter är etiketten för horisontell axel. border: Denna parameter används för att ställa in kantfärg för varje stapel. xlim: Denna parameter används för att plotta värden på x-axeln. ylim: Denna parameter används för att plotta värden på y-axeln. breaks: Denna parameter används som bredd på varje stapel.
Skapa ett enkelt histogram i R
Skapa ett enkelt histogramdiagram genom att använda ovanstående parameter. Denna vektor i är plot använder hist() .
Exempel:
R
# Create data for the graph.> v <-> c> (19, 23, 11, 5, 16, 21, 32,> > 14, 19, 27, 39)> # Create the histogram.> hist> (v, xlab => 'No.of Articles '> ,> > col => 'green'> , border => 'black'> )> |
Produktion:
Histogram i R-språk
Område av X- och Y-värden
För att beskriva värdeintervallet måste vi göra följande steg:
- Vi kan använda parametrarna xlim och ylim i X-axeln och Y-axeln.
- Ta alla parametrar som krävs för att göra ett histogramdiagram.
Exempel
R
# Create data for the graph.> v <-> c> (19, 23, 11, 5, 16, 21, 32, 14, 19, 27, 39)> # Create the histogram.> hist> (v, xlab => 'No.of Articles'> , col => 'green'> ,> > border => 'black'> , xlim => c> (0, 50),> > ylim => c> (0, 5), breaks = 5)> |
Produktion:
Histogram i R-språk
Använda histogramreturvärden för etiketter som använder text()
För att skapa ett histogramreturvärdediagram.
R
# Creating data for the graph.> v <-> c> (19, 23, 11, 5, 16, 21, 32, 14, 19,> > 27, 39, 120, 40, 70, 90)> # Creating the histogram.> m <-> hist> (v, xlab => 'Weight'> , ylab => 'Frequency'> ,> > col => 'darkmagenta'> , border => 'pink'> ,> > breaks = 5)> # Setting labels> text> (m$mids, m$counts, labels = m$counts,> > adj => c> (0.5, -0.5))> |
Produktion:
Histogram i R-språk
Histogram med ojämn bredd
Genom att skapa histogramdiagram med olika bredd, med hjälp av ovanstående parametrar, skapade vi ett histogram med olikformig bredd.
Exempel
R
# Creating data for the graph.> v <-> c> (19, 23, 11, 5, 16, 21, 32, 14,> > 19, 27, 39, 120, 40, 70, 90)> > # Creating the histogram.> hist> (v, xlab => 'Weight'> , ylab => 'Frequency'> ,> > xlim => c> (50, 100),> > col => 'darkmagenta'> , border => 'pink'> ,> > breaks => c> (5, 55, 60, 70, 75,> > 80, 100, 140))> |
Produktion:
Histogram i R-språk